How much do weekend basketball game clock operator j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 7, 2026, the average hourly pay for weekend basketball game clock operator in the United States is $18.14,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$13.70 and $20.19 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ges faced by Weekend Basketball Game Clock Operators, and how can they be managed?

Weekend Basketball Game Clock Operators often face the challenge of maintaining intense focus during fast-paced games, as even a minor lapse can impact the game's outcome. Miscommunication with referees or table officials can also occur, especially during high-pressure moments like the end of quarters or close games. To manage these challenges, operators should familiarize themselves thoroughly with the game rules, attend pre-game briefings, and establish clear communication with officials. Practicing with the clock equipment beforehand and staying calm under pressure also contribute to effective performance in this role.

What are Weekend Basketball Game Clock Operators?

Weekend Basketball Game Clock Operators are individuals responsible for managing the official game clock and scoreboard during basketball games held on weekends. Their main duties include starting and stopping the clock according to game rules, updating the score, and ensuring all timing-related aspects of the game are accurate. They work closely with referees and other game officials to maintain the flow and fairness of the game. Attention to detail, knowledge of basketball rules, and the ability to concentrate in a busy environment are essential for this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Weekend Basketball Game Clock Operator,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Weekend Basketball Game Clock Operator, you need a thorough understanding of basketball rules, attention to detail, and general timekeeping skills, often with a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with scoreboard and timing systems, such as Daktronics or similar equipment, is typically required. Strong focus, quick decision-making, and clear communication with referees and event staff are important soft skills. These abilities ensure accurate game timing and smooth event operations, which are critical for fairness and professionalism in competitive basketball environments.

What is the difference between Weekend Basketball Game Clock Operator vs Basketball Official?

AspectWeekend Basketball Game Clock OperatorBasketball Official
CredentialsBasic training, knowledge of game clock operationReferee certification, training in rules and officiating
Work EnvironmentSports venues, gyms during gamesOn-court during game play, in the arena
Employer & IndustrySchools, recreational leagues, sports clubsLeagues, tournaments, high school and college games

While both roles are essential during basketball games, the Weekend Basketball Game Clock Operator primarily manages the game clock and timer, focusing on technical operation. In contrast, a Basketball Official enforces game rules, makes calls, and ensures fair play. Both positions require specific training, but officials typically undergo certification and officiating courses, whereas clock operators focus on technical skills. Understanding these differences helps clarify each role's responsibilities during a game.
